About Martel LeSueur

A Patriot of the American Revolution for VIRGINIA with the rank of PRIVATE. DAR Ancestor #: A069552

Find a Grave Memorial Pvt Martel LeSueur

Martel LeSueur, the son of David and Elizabeth Chastain LeSueur, was born March 6, 1758 in Manakintowne, Virginia and died August 10, 1843. At a special ceremony his stone was placed in the Prillaman-Turner Cemetery in Virginia. His wife, Elizabeth, and other family members are buried here.

On 10 June 1781 he married Elizabeth Bacon in Chesterfield County, Virginia. They had ten children:

John Ludwell b. 22 Dec 1782 Mary "Polly" b. 19 Jan 1784 Martha "Patsey" b. 18 Feb 1787 d.26 Feb 1867 Elizabeth "Betsy" b. 05 Mar 1789 Lucy b. 09 Apr 1792 Moseley b. 02 Oct 1795 d.28 Aug 1824 James Washington b. 15 Oct 1798 d.31 May 1871 Catherine "Sally" b. 08 Apr 1800 Dorothea Bacon b. 02 Oct 1802 Grandison Bacon b. 07 Mar 1805 d.01 Mar 1897

Pvt. Martel LeSueur served as a soldier in several units during the Revolutionary War.

FROM PENSION APPLICATION W8035, MARTEL AND ELIZABETH BACON LESUEUR: APPEARING BEFORE A FRANKLIN CO VA JUSTICE OF THE PEACE ON 18 FEB 1833, MARTEL LESUEUR STATED HE WAS 71 YEARS OF AGE, BEING BORN IN THE YEAR 1761 AND HIS BIRTH IS REGISTERED IN THE CHURCH OF THE PARISH OF KING WILLIAM. HE FURTHER STATED THAT HE WAS BORN IN MANAKEN [SIC] BEING INITIALLY IN THE COUNTY OF CUMBERLAND, NOW IN THE COUNTY OF POWHATAN.

THIS DIFFERS FROM THE INFORMATION PROVIDED BY ELIZABETH BACON LESUEUR WHO GIVES HER HUSBAND'S DATE OF BIRTH AS 06 MAR 1756.

BOTH DATES DIFFER FROM THE TOMBSTONE WHICH HAS 6 MAR 1758 AS THE DATE OF BIRTH.

SOURCE: REVOLUTIONARY WARRIORS AND WIDOWS OF HENRY, FRANKLIN, PATRICK AND FLOYD COUNTIES OF VIRGINIA, PENSION APPLICATIONS TRANSCRIBED AND ANNOTATED BY C. LEON HARRIS, PAGES 223-224 THE ABOVE INFORMATION ON MARTEL LESUEUR'S DATE OF BIRTH WAS PROVIDED BY REBECCA REUBEN DYER.
